Antique French Confit Pot with lid - mottled glaze two handled stoneware, pale brown and ecru, early to mid 1900s 19th century service 75cm diameter) 8 in excellentA lovely French antique stoneware confit pot with lid, dating to the early 20th century. Traditionally used for cooking and preserving meats in the days before refrigerators, this piece has a beautifully simple, rustic form with smooth hand molded handles and a gorgeous, chocolate brown matt glaze.
